Output 110438f86103b0120bcd67acb24b318e8d0c6f2a5ecdba779b5c845a05296259:3

value
540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bb8b4ca591df7e1e221552f8ceae9d07d8e7966 OP_EQUAL
address
38bPsYVB1oZWKdPmRfHm1QKk6BFbzWuXgb
transaction
110438f86103b0120bcd67acb24b318e8d0c6f2a5ecdba779b5c845a05296259
spent
true